Frog meat wrapped in betel leaves is a fried dish commonly found in most family meals in the Mekong Delta, delicious and highly nutritious. Today, the Into the Kitchen section of TasteVN will share with you the recipe for this delicious dish!

Ingredients for Frog Meat Wrapped in Betel Leaves Serves 5

Minced frog 600 gr Pork sausage 200 gr Chicken egg 1 piece Fried flour 70 gr Betel leaves 50 gr Spring onions 3 stalks Red onions 5 bulbs Garlic 1/2 bulb Cooking oil 100 ml Fish sauce 1/2 tablespoon Pepper/ seasoning powder 1/2 tablespoon

How to choose fresh ingredients

How to choose good frog meat

  • The best time for frogs is around September onwards, when they are storing high levels of fat and nutrition for the winter break, so at this time they are very plump and meaty.
  • When buying, you should choose wild frogs instead of farmed frogs because wild frogs have sweeter, fattier meat and a more special aroma.
  • Choose frogs with bright eyes, a slender head, a body with veins, a white or slightly yellowish belly skin, and the skin of the body should have green or yellow mottling.
  • Avoid frogs with large heads, soft and mushy meat, slow movements, and uniformly black skin because they are usually frogs that have been farmed for a long time and the meat will not be good.

You can choose to buy frogs and ask the seller to grind them on the spot or buy pre-processed frogs and grind them using a mixer.

Where to buy fresh pork sausage? How to choose fresh pork sausage

  • You should choose fresh pork sausage that has a natural pinkish-white color, soft meat, and has a certain elasticity when pressed.
  • Good fresh pork sausage is stored in a cool place, vacuum-sealed carefully, has a certain smoothness, and does not have a foul smell.
  • Avoid buying fresh pork sausage that is overly white or too dark (as it may have been colored with food coloring or fat), is not well preserved, and has a foul smell.
  • When buying, you should carefully check the place of production and the expiration date of the product. It is advisable to buy products from reputable places to ensure quality.

How to make Frog Meat Wrapped in Betel Leaves

  • Prepare the ingredients

    Green onions cut off the roots, wash clean, drain and chop finely.

    Betel leaves wash clean, drain and then cut into thin strips.

    Garlic and shallots should be peeled, washed, drained and minced finely.

  • Marinate the meat mixture

    In a large bowl, add 600gr of minced frog meat, 200gr of pork paste, 70gr of crispy flour, 1 chicken egg, a little chopped green onion, 1 teaspoon minced garlic, 1 teaspoon minced shallots, a little chopped betel leaves, 1/2 tablespoon fish sauce, 1/2 tablespoon seasoning powder, and 1 teaspoon pepper.

    Then mix this mixture thoroughly until the seasonings are evenly absorbed.

    Tip: You can adjust the ingredients to suit your family’s taste!

  • Fry the frog cake

    Place a pan on the stove and wait for it to heat up, then add 100ml of cooking oil.

    When the oil is hot, press the marinated meat mixture into bite-sized pieces. Then add them to the pan and fry on low heat to ensure that the cakes are cooked evenly from the outside in.

    Continuously turn them until both sides are evenly golden, crispy, and fragrant, then transfer them to a plate.

  • Final product

    You have completed the delicious and nutritious frog cake with betel leaves. The fragrant aroma of betel leaves, garlic, and onion when fried is really enticing, isn’t it?

    Taking a bite will immediately let you feel the crunchy, sweet, and wonderfully chewy frog meat. Eating it with fresh herbs and sweet garlic chili sauce is just perfect!
